1. The Rise of Artificial Intelligence (AI) in Cybersecurity

Artificial Intelligence is revolutionizing how antivirus software detects and mitigates threats. Traditional antivirus solutions relied heavily on signature-based detection methods, which could only identify known threats. However, as cybercriminals become more sophisticated, there is a growing need for innovative detection techniques.

Benefits of AI in antivirus software:

  • Real-time threat detection: AI can analyze and recognize patterns in user behavior, allowing for the immediate identification of anomalies.
  • Predictive capabilities: Using machine learning algorithms, AI can predict future threats based on historical data, enhancing the software's proactive measures.
  • Automated response: AI-driven solutions can automatically contain and mitigate threats without requiring human intervention.

3. Integrated Cybersecurity Solutions

The need for a comprehensive approach to cybersecurity is leading to a surge in integrated solutions that combine antivirus software with other security measures. This trend is especially important in business environments where multiple vulnerabilities can exist.

Components of an integrated solution:

Component Description
Firewall A barrier that monitors and controls incoming and outgoing network traffic based on predetermined security rules.
Intrusion Detection Systems (IDS) Tools that monitor network traffic for suspicious activity and alert administrators.
Virtual Private Networks (VPN) Secure communication channels through which users can access the internet while remaining anonymous.

4. Transition to Cloud-Based Antivirus Solutions

As cloud technology continues to advance, many antivirus software providers are moving towards cloud-based solutions. This shift offers several advantages, especially concerning updates and maintenance.

Advantages of cloud-based antivirus:

  • Automatic updates: Users benefit from real-time updates without needing to install patches manually.
  • Resource efficiency: Leveraging cloud computing allows software to use more powerful data processing capabilities.
  • Scalability: Businesses can scale their security solutions based on their needs, making it flexible and cost-effective.
